Windows とMacで文字化けしないようにするShift-JISとUTF-8の理解と活用法

WindowsMacを活用したデータ連携を伴う作業では、コード系の問題が発生します。

時として全角文字のコード系不一致は、文字化けや無変換が起きる事態になります。
関連記事:sqlite3 でimportした際、全角が空欄になってしまったときの対処方法

Shft-JIS・・・Microsoftにより定められた文字コードの1つ(JIS規格)。すべての文字を2バイトで管理。

UTF-8・・・ASCIIコードと互換性があり世界中の言語を1~4バイトで管理。全角文字は3バイト。


使い分け(簡単な見分け方)
Shft-JIS
Microsoftが関与しているWindows、Windows上で動作するアプリケーション(EXCEL、Wordなど)

UTF-8
Mac国際的な利用がなされているアプリケーション(WordPressなど)

 

上部へスクロール
Verified by MonsterInsights